Solution for -8(-3+a)=160 equation:


Simplifying
-8(-3 + a) = 160
(-3 * -8 + a * -8) = 160
(24 + -8a) = 160

Solving
24 + -8a = 160

Solving for variable 'a'.

Move all terms containing a to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-24' to each side of the equation.
24 + -24 + -8a = 160 + -24

Combine like terms: 24 + -24 = 0
0 + -8a = 160 + -24
-8a = 160 + -24

Combine like terms: 160 + -24 = 136
-8a = 136

Divide each side by '-8'.
a = -17

Simplifying
a = -17
